GE Aerospace
INDUSTRIALS · AEROSPACE & DEFENSE · USA
General Electric Company (GE) is an American multinational conglomerate incorporated in New York City and headquartered in Boston. As of 2018, the company operates through the following segments: aviation, healthcare, power, renewable energy, digital industry, additive manufacturing and venture capital and finance.
Innovative Solutions and Support
INDUSTRIALS · AEROSPACE & DEFENSE · USA
Innovative Solutions and Support, Inc., a systems integrator, designs, develops, manufactures, sells, and provides flight guidance, auto-throttle, and cockpit display systems services in the United States and internationally. The company is headquartered in Exton, Pennsylvania.
